About David Marx
David Marx is a scholar working on Atomic and Molecular Physics, and Optics, Electrical and Electronic Engineering, Astronomy and Astrophysics, Radiology, Nuclear Medicine and Imaging and Infectious Diseases, having authored 35 papers that have together received 572 indexed citations. Recurring topics across this work include Adaptive optics and wavefront sensing (8 papers), Optical Systems and Laser Technology (6 papers), Stellar, planetary, and galactic studies (4 papers), Cardiac Imaging and Diagnostics (4 papers), Renal Transplantation Outcomes and Treatments (3 papers), Cardiac Ischemia and Reperfusion (3 papers), Advanced MRI Techniques and Applications (3 papers) and Advanced Proteomics Techniques and Applications (2 papers). The work is most often cited by research in Transplantation (76 citations), Nephrology (94 citations), Instrumentation (19 citations), Cardiology and Cardiovascular Medicine (78 citations) and Pathology and Forensic Medicine (57 citations). David Marx has collaborated with scholars based in United States, France and Germany. Frequent co-authors include Edward O. McFalls, Herbert B. Ward, Jochen Metzger, Agnieszka Latosińska, Maria Frantzi, Harald Mischak, Holger Husi, Antonia Vlahou, Joseph J. Sikora and Wilfried Gwinner. Their work appears in journals such as American Journal of Physiology-Heart and Circulatory Physiology, PROTEOMICS - CLINICAL APPLICATIONS, Journal of Astronomical Telescopes Instruments and Systems, American Journal of Transplantation and Basic Research in Cardiology.
